Nettet7. jul. 2024 · Import your image into Inkscape. Draw a mask on top of the image. The fill must be 100% white. In TD's example it's an ellipse. Blur the mask. Select both the mask and the image. Object > Mask > Set. If you need to reposition the image within the masked area you'll have to use Object > Mask > Release, then repeat steps 4 & 5 above.

In this short #tutorial / #tip video I will demonstrate how to create uniform border for shapes in … Nettet5. sep. 2013 · Here's how you use it: Select the path that you want to modify and then open the path effects tab under Path > Path Effects.... Add a new effect in the path effects window and select Fillet/Chamfer. Choose a radius that you want to apply to the corners of the path, and press the Fillet button.
